> There is no vu-meter in tracks, so we don't know where the signals come from, neither at each level it comes.
> 
> There is no peak value detection, we don't know what was the last highest peak value,
> to find out what sound would overhelm the mixing equilibrium.
> 
> Using different colors for the different bus is a very good idea, and make gaining time 
> for finding the good slider,
> but some colors gives Mx an ugly apparence that could be avoided with choosing
> harmonious tones, for example a yellow handle over a white background slider, is just
> a pain for the eyes. Also the green color is very agressive. 
> 
> Mixing sounds is a kind of computation where the engineer need know accurately
> which level he has to give to some tracks for getting a correct average power,
> for example if we add 3 Decibels we double power...
> The necessary stuff is just a number box that would tell how much Db is modulated over a slider.

> here is my favorite mixing tool:
> 
> http://www.soundonsound.com/sos/jan07/images/cubase5_l.jpg
> 
> _ we can choose DAC~ input and output bus
> _ phase inversion
> _ Gain level
> _ Panning is over the number of output buses we choose
> _ A 'Listen' button has been added with 'Solo', but I didn't use it yet.
> _ we can record/play automation from the board.
> _ we can choose if the signal that goes to the bus is pre or post fader.
> _ same for vu-meter (all)
> _ we can record stuff passing through the mixer, if it's audio it records audio, if it's midi it records midi
> _ we can access directly to the instrument from the mixer track.
> _ there is an internal EQ, very usefull and very well implemented into to mixer track.
> _ we can group tracks into group tracks.
> _ we can save settings of each parts of the mixer.
> 
> there are also all the settings that has effect on all the the tracks, like hiding all different parts of the tracks
> or setting peak detection time, copy-paste track params, an track edit window  (so we can see all settings) ...

> Have you checked mx from netpd? 
> http://www.netpd.org/Mx
> 
> I am not sure, if it meets your criteria, but some of it features are:
> 
> - slot for insert-fx per channel/master channel
> - unlimited number of slots for aux-fx
> - aux-fx can be chained
> - you can write your own fx
> 
> By using some additional fx plugin suites, you can have:
> 
> - meta-fx, that pack 3 slots into one (this way you can have as many
> inserts in a chain as you want)
> - dynamic processing fx
> - EQs
> - time-based fx, such chorus, flanger, phaser
> - some funky freaky stuff, such as spectral-delay, fft-based
> pitchshifter and more.
